Understanding the fundamentals of wine tasting begins with familiarity with the key parts. The primary elements contributing to flavor are sweetness, acidity, tannin, and alcohol - Visit the Secret Treasures of Sebastopol Wineries. Every wine has its unique stability, influenced by the grape variety, area, and vinification process. Recognizing these elements permits a taster to appreciate the complexity in every sip.

Visual examination is step one within the tasting course of. Swirling the wine in a glass oxygenates it, bringing out the aromas which might be crucial to understanding the wine's essence. Observing colours ranging from deep purple to pale straw offers perception into the wine's age and variety. The clarity and brilliance of the wine additionally offer clues about its quality.
Subsequent, the olfactory experience takes precedence. The nostril is often thought-about essentially the most crucial a part of tasting. Constructing an awareness of widespread aromas may be helpful. Fruits, flowers, spices, and earthy notes are often current. Taking time to inhale deeply earlier than tasting permits for a more profound appreciation of a wine's bouquet.

When it comes to tasting, the method must be deliberate and thoughtful. Small sips are advisable, permitting the wine to linger in the mouth. This technique allows the taster to discern the complex layers of flavors. Noting the preliminary taste, the mid-palate, and the end contributes to a complete understanding of the wine’s profile.
One Other crucial side of wine tasting is the understanding of stability and construction. A well-balanced wine presents harmonious flavors where no single component overwhelms the others. Analyzing how acidity interacts with sweetness and tannins will help in assessing the general composition of the wine.
Wines can differ considerably from one vintage to another because of environmental elements, which makes understanding the idea of terroir important. Terroir refers back to the geographical and climatic conditions, as nicely as the winemaking practices that affect the ultimate product. This relationship between the land and the wine can influence its flavor spectrum dramatically.

- Begin by observing the wine’s appearance; tilt the glass to assess readability, colour intensity, and viscosity as these factors can indicate the wine's age and physique.
- Swirl the wine gently within the glass to release its aromatic compounds, enhancing the olfactory experience.
- Take a second to inhale the aromas before tasting; note the complexity and the primary scent categories corresponding to fruity, earthy, floral, or spicy.
- When tasting, permit a small amount of wine to cover your palate, guaranteeing to pay consideration to the preliminary style, mid-palate flavors, and finish to evaluate its construction.
- Pay attention to the tannins present; they can affect the texture and mouthfeel, giving insights into the wine's getting older potential.
- Think About the acidity level, which might provide freshness to the wine, balancing sweetness and enhancing food pairings.
- Use a scorecard or journal to jot down observations about each wine, together with flavors, aromas, and personal impressions to check later.
- Experiment with food pairings during tastings, as this can considerably enhance or change the notion of the wine’s flavor profile.
- Interact in discussions with fellow tasters to share perspectives, which might broaden the appreciation and understanding of different wines.

How do I correctly smell wine?

To properly scent wine, comply with these steps: first, hold the glass on the base, swirl it gently to aerate, then convey it to your nose. Take a quantity of brief sniffs to capture the preliminary fragrances, followed by a deeper inhale to discover the more advanced aromas. Focus on identifying specific scents like fruits, spices, and different descriptors.

What should I look for when tasting wine?

When tasting wine, search for several key components: look (color and clarity), aroma (fruits, herbs, and spices), flavor (sweetness, acidity, tannins), and texture (body and mouthfeel). Additionally, consider the wine's finish, which is the lingering taste after swallowing. All these elements contribute to the wine's total profile.
How do I know if a wine is good quality?
Good quality wine generally has balance amongst its parts, which means that acidity, tannins, sweetness, and alcohol work harmoniously together. Look for complexity in flavors and aromas and a long, pleasant finish. High Quality wines additionally sometimes exhibit distinct characteristics reflecting their varietal and area.

Is it important to make use of particular glassware for wine tasting?
Sure, utilizing particular glassware enhances the wine tasting experience. Acceptable glasses can influence the aroma and flavor perception. For example, a Bordeaux glass is designed to enhance full-bodied pink wines by permitting oxygen to work together with them, whereas a narrower flute is good for glowing wines to protect carbonation.

What are some widespread wine tasting errors to avoid?
Widespread wine tasting mistakes embrace not properly cleansing your palate between wines, serving wines at incorrect temperatures, and overlooking the importance of the glass form. Additionally, being overly influenced by others' opinions can cloud your individual tasting experience; all the time trust your personal palate.

Am I Able To taste wines at a winery without making a reservation?
Whereas some wineries offer walk-in tastings, many require reservations, especially on weekends or during peak seasons. It’s best to verify forward with the winery for their insurance policies on tastings to ensure a easy experience. Reservations also allow you to have a extra personalized and educational go to.
